USS Uranus (AF-14) 1944
}} '''USS ''Uranus'' (AF-14) was a bareboat chartered to the U.S. Navy by the War Shipping Administration for use in World War II. The ship was one of the Danish vessels idled in U.S. ports seized by the United States after the occupation of Denmark by German forces. The ship was the Danish J. Lauritzen A/S line vessel ''Maria'', ex ''Caravelle'', ex ''Helga''''' until chartered to the Navy and commissioned on 11 August 1941 under the name ''Uranus''.

''Uranus'' served in both the North Atlantic Ocean and the Pacific Ocean, delivering food, including refrigerated items, to ships operating in the battle areas.

The ship was returned to Denmark and later, under new Danish naming rules, named ''Maria Dan'' until sold to Greece to be renamed ''Michael'' in 1959. The ship was scrapped in 1968. Provided by Wikipedia
